— HOW IT WORKS —

This is the app that wants you to use it less.
Before dinner, you get a nudge: a Reggio-inspired conversation starter tailored to your child's exact age. "What was the scariest part of your day?" "If your stuffed animals could talk, what would they say about you?"
Then the phone goes dark. No notifications. No check-ins. No reason to pick it up. Your kid has your full attention.
After bedtime — when the house is quiet and the guilt-free phone time begins — you open the app for 10 seconds. Tap how present you felt (1 to 5 hearts). Jot a one-line memory if you want. Add a photo from today. Done.
That's it. That's the whole habit.

— FEATURES —

· Personalized Saturday countdown for each child based on their exact birthday
· Age-appropriate conversation starters inspired by the Reggio Emilia philosophy
· Daily reflection with warmth scale (1-5 hearts) and one-line memory journal
· Photo journal that feeds into weekly, monthly, and yearly recaps
· Presence streak with grace days — because life happens and missing a day doesn't erase what you've built
· Shareable milestone cards for Instagram, Messages, and more
· Smart notifications that know when to nudge and when to be silent
· Multi-child support with individual tracking
· All data stored locally on your phone. We never see your children's names, ages, or photos. Ever.
· Designed to be opened twice a day: once before the moment, once after. Never during.
